Hello marci01. I hear you loud and clear and want to help. If you're still having this trouble, please let me know if this just start happening on the 21st. Also, is it on random calls, or calls with particular people, or when you're in a particular area? Are you using the phone with a corded headset or a Bluetooth by any chance? Sometimes, network connection issues on the iPhone 4/4s can be resolved by simply dialing *228 and choosing option 2, followed by restarting the phone http://bit.ly/tXe7I4. It won't erase your phone information, but is a great way to re-establish the communication between your phone and the network.

Hi Maria C, just wanted to give you and this posting an update; spoke to Apple care about an hour ago. There, is in fact, a sensor to dim the screen, apple tech said 1st solution take off the plastic clear screen cover if one was put on, that's where the sensor is and mine was just 25% covered so I took it off, still mute on my ear, still ends call when power on/off is pushed during call. He informed me to do a restore, which we did both to factory settings and back up from restore. I have to go to the Apple store tomorrow. I'm not trying to be rude or tell you you're wrong, but I wanted to assist anyone else who is experiencing this problem. Also, antenna is on bottom left if phone is facing you which is why coverage may be weak. He said the case really doesn't matter but for testing purposes to take it off, we tested on wi-fi and 3G and I did in fact have less coverage.
